Our hotel wasn't far from Times Square and Broadway. On the first day, we did a fair amount of shopping (Mum, Dad, just so you know, there's a box on it's way home) before meeting up with some of Lauras friends that she worked with in Japan.
After we left them, we went up to the 102nd floor of the Empire State Building. The view from the top makes the rest of the skyscrapers around NY look small, that just makes Adelaide look like a tiny little ant farm.
Tuesday night we saw Wicked on Broadway, Wednesday night we saw Chicago. Wicked was awesome, of the three musicals we've seen on this trip, it takes first place (Les Mis takes second, Chicago third) Chicago was pretty good, but Wicked was much better.
On our final day in NY, we went took a ride on the Staten Island ferry for views of the Statue of Liberty. Later we went to Ground Zero, the former site of the Twin Towers. The whole area was closed off with construction, but you could still see where the two buildings once stood. Kinda eery.
